UNDESIRABLE MEDICAL ADVERTISEMENTS (AMENDMENT) BILL 1988

"(3) Where, in an advertisement published in contraven- tion of subsection (1), a person named in that advertisement is held out-

(a) as being a manufacturer or supplier of medicine or

surgical appliances; or

(b) as being able to provide any treatment,

that person is presumed, until the contrary is proved, to have caused the advertisement to be published.

(4) Where an advertisement published in contravention of subsection (1) gives the name, address or telephone number of, or indicates some other means of contacting, a person, and that person-

(a) manufactures or supplies medicine or surgical

appliances; or

(b) provides any treatment,

that person is presumed, until the contrary is proved, to have caused the advertisement to be published.

(5) For the purposes of subsection (1) neither of the following shall constitute the publication of an advertise-

ment—

(a) the sale or supply, or exposure for sale or supply, of

any-

(i) medicine;

(ii) surgical appliance; or

(iii) treatment,

in a labelled container or package;

(b) the supply, inside any container or package con- taining any medicine, surgical appliance or treat- ment, of information relating to that or any other medicine, surgical appliance or treatment.

(6) Subsection (5) shall cease to have effect on the commencement of Part II of the Undesirable Medical Adver- tisements (Amendment) Ordinance 1988.".

The following is added after section 3-

"Restrictions affecting labelled

containers and packages

Schedule 3

3A. (1) Except with the authority of the Director of Medical and Health Services, no person shall sell or supply, or expose for sale or supply, any medicine, surgical appliance or treatment in a labelled container or package if that labelled container or package is likely to lead to the use of that medicine, surgical appliance or treatment for treating human beings for any purpose specified in Schedule 3.
